Transaction 64b1dfa2f88a65e6fbb67be4977cdf3e474f45040dc1d1518e1082efcfcad75b

2 Input
1 Outputs
  • 64b1dfa2f88a65e6fbb67be4977cdf3e474f45040dc1d1518e1082efcfcad75b:0
  • value  151888
    address  3LPyX2MXz2h4RRRe9tdMoxfecFX9gcftZJ